  5. LY127210 free base

LY127210 free base is an orally active peripheral arterial vasodilating antihypertensive agent. LY127210 free base interferes with the baroreflex mechanism, exerts direct myocardial bradycardic activity, has no α or β receptor blocking properties, and acts via all conventional administration routes. LY127210 free base reduces vascular resistance, cardiac output, heart rate, left ventricular end-diastolic pressure, regional vascular resistance, as well as blood flow in the skin and cerebral cortex. LY127210 free base can be used in research related to hypertension.

In Vivo

LY127210 (10 mg/kg; i.p.; single dose) free base reduces mean arterial pressure by 35% in chloralose-anesthetized spontaneously hypertensive rats via a 26% reduction in systemic vascular resistance and a smaller reduction in cardiac output, without inducing reflex tachycardia[1].

Animal Model: SHR (male, 16-18 weeks old, 280-330g, anesthetized with methohexital followed by α-chloralose infusion)[1]
Dosage: 10 mg/kg
Administration: i.p.; single dose
Result: Reduced mean arterial pressure by 35% from baseline at 5 minutes post-dosing.
Reduced systemic vascular resistance by 26% from baseline at 5 minutes post-dosing.
Reduced left ventricular end-diastolic pressure by 41% from baseline at 5 minutes post-dosing.
Decreased heart rate by 4% from baseline at 5 minutes post-dosing, with an additional 2% decrease at 20 minutes post-dosing.
Decreased skin blood flow by 30% and cerebral cortex blood flow by 16%.
Reduced vascular resistance in kidney, cerebral cortex, ileum, and skin.
Produced non-significant decreases in cardiac output, stroke volume, and LVdP/dt max at 5 minutes post-dosing.
Maintained all hemodynamic changes for at least 20 minutes post-dosing.
